The cost of producing 200 tons of ore powder per day varies depending on various factors such as the type of mill, labor cost, electricity cost, raw material cost, and other expenses. Here is a table that provides an estimate of the cost of producing 200 tons of ore powder per day using different types of mills:


| Type of Mill | Cost per Ton | Total Cost per Day |

|---------------|-----------------|------------------------|

| Ball Mill | $50-$100 | $10,000-$20,000 |

| Raymond Mill | $60-$120 | $12,000-$24,000 |

| Ultrafine Mill | $80-$160 | $16,000-$32,000 |

| Vertical Mill | $70-$140 | $14,000-$28,000 |


Please note that these are only estimates and the actual cost may vary depending on the specific manufacturer, location, and other factors.
